4. |
Hotels
|
(a) |
Main Urban Areas & New Towns |
|
| |
|
- |
1 car space per 100 rooms.
|
- |
In addition, for hotels with conference and banquet facilities:
0.5-1 car space per 200m2 GFA of conference and banquet facilities. |
|
|
|
| |
|
- |
Car parking spaces are for the use of hotel limousines and the operational needs of staff. |
|
| |
|
- |
Loading/unloading bays for goods vehicles: 0.5-1 goods vehicle bay per 100 rooms.

Additional provision for convention centres and banquet facilities to be determined by the Authority. |
|
| |
|
- |
Bays to be located close to the service entrance. Manoeuvring of goods vehicles should be within the curtilage of the site; generally no reversing movement into/from a public road will be permitted.
|
- |
Layout should be such that vehicles ingress, pick-up/set down, egress with no reversing movement nor tailback into a public road. Adequate passenger waiting area to be provided adjacent to lay-by.
|
- |
Lay-by should be such that bus ingress, egress with no tailback into a public road. Adequate passenger waiting area to be provided adjacent to lay-by. |

4. |
Hotels
|
(b) |
Other areas |
|
| |
|
- |
Not less than 1 single-deck tour bus parking space for every 200 guest rooms or part thereof.
|
- |
Not less than 1 car parking space for every 10 guest rooms.
|
- |
Additional provision for hotels with conference and banquet facilities:
2-5 car spaces per 200m2 GFA of conference and banquet facilities |
|
| |
|
- |
Access to and egress from parking areas should be from a minor road within the confines of the sites.
|
- |
Provision is subject to any Closed Road Permit policies et al. |
|
| |
|
- |
Not less than 1 bay for goods vehicles for every 100 guest rooms or part thereof.
|
- |
Additional provision for convention centres and banquet facilities to be determined by the Authority. |
|
|
5. |
Commercial Entertainment Facilities (e.g. cinemas, theatres.) |
|
- |
Range of 0 to 1 car parking space for every 20 seats or part thereof. |
|
- |
Generally no provision for cinemas in the Metropolitan Area as these are mostly in areas well served by public transport. |
|
- |
Except for cinemas, 1 loading/unloading bay for goods vehicles where practicable.
|
- |
Not less than 1 picking up/setting down lay-by for taxis and private cars for every 400 seats or part thereof.
|
- |
In preparation of development plans, some additional lay-bys for taxis and private cars should be incorporated in the vicinity of known cinemas, theatres and the like. |
